When you’re online, you put your privacy and identity at risk. It’s true when they say that everything you do online is detectable, from your IP address down to your exact location. Given that fact, our online security is unstable and hence, should be improved. As we make the most of the Internet, we also have to take care of our online security. This way, we don’t have to worry much about our real identity and online reputation getting destroyed by some hacker or identity thief.

These days, also with the aid of technology, there are several online security measures available for people to use and integrate into their online activities. Perhaps, we can start in our email system. To ensure privacy and authenticity of one’s mail, we could get encryption software, digital signature and modern cryptography techniques and services. All of these security products and services are designed to eliminate threats to and provide maximum security for your emails. While they can be adopted by anyone, they are more useful when you work in the corporate world where competition is at the toughest and everything is spied on.

Online security should be one of the primary concerns of everyone that goes online for work, business or even leisure. Starting early in protecting yourself from identity thieves and hackers goes a long way in ensuring a trouble-free and productive online experience.
